Army Jobs: Young people who take the JEE Main 2025 exam can also fulfill their dream of becoming an officer in the Indian Army. Tomorrow is the last date to apply for the Army’s 55th 10+2 Technical Entry Scheme.

The application process for this recruitment began on October 14th. Online applications can be made by visiting the Indian Army website, joinindianarmy.nic.in.

The most important thing is that there will be no written examination in the 55th 10+2 Technical Entry Scheme recruitment process. Only passing the SSB interview is required. Only unmarried men can apply for this recruitment. A total of 90 vacant posts will be filled.

Eligibility for the 10+2 Technical Entry Scheme
For this scheme, candidates must have passed the 12th standard (PCM) with 60% marks and must also have taken the JEE Main 2025 exam.

Age Limit

The age limit for this recruitment should be between 16 and 19 years. Must have been born no earlier than January 2, 2007, and no later than January 1, 2010.

Selection Process
After applying, candidates will be shortlisted for the SSB based on their JEE Main score and 12th-grade marks. Upon passing, they will undergo a medical examination.

Lieutenant Rank After Four Years of Training
Selected candidates will undergo four years of training. Upon completion of the course, they will receive an engineering degree and a permanent commission at the rank of Lieutenant. Upon commission, they will receive a salary package of approximately ₹18 lakh per annum and various benefits.
